Output 56694a006df25ec06893c35ca9c6c30e95dc3219ef53fe6523a3d4f136c5348c:5

value
7601887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8227879d52f0c8e9273c01315592b81169cbea OP_EQUAL
address
3Hh26QE1h6FUZn4rQSmbPRLguGdJwHytKo
transaction
56694a006df25ec06893c35ca9c6c30e95dc3219ef53fe6523a3d4f136c5348c
spent
true